    Over the last couple months I trained extensively with a purple belt from Japan who trains at Caol Uno's place -- he was preparing for the worlds. I'm not sure what exactly they teach, but this guy is an absolute beast, as well as being a super nice guy. I feel pity for his opponents tomorrow.

    He says that Uno is a monster wrestler but not as good with the gi because he leaves himself open for neck chokes all the time.

    Basically it seems they train mostly ground-based no-gi grappling. A very tight, smash-y game.

    Wajyutsu Keisyukai is a gym founded by a Judoka , Yoshinori Nishi, winner of the first Lumax cup and the same guy that fought against rickson in some valetudo japan.

    I don't think that Wajyutsu is style itself, but a mma Gym. A lot of guy train there with different background (Uno is a wrestler, Okami Akiyama and Dong Kim are judoka for examples)
